e-brake issue. handle only clicks in 1 spot

I bought a 2003 Z4 and the handbrake lever only clicks at what I would assume is 3-4 clicks up. I can pull the handle up more but it drops back to the middle spot. I feel very light bumps in the button as if it is just not grabbing the teeth all the way.

I have a feeling that this is an e-brake assembly issue and the whole part may need replacement. I figured I'd ask some Z4 vets before I go dropping some cash.

Your feeling is probably right, but it's odd so many teeth are worn. You could verify the teeth are indeed worn. It may be the ratchet pawl spring is weak, or the pawl itself is worn. I don't think you can buy these parts separately, but could maybe get them from a scrap yard.

You could limp along a bit by adjusting the cable so the one place the lever catches is the proper tension.
